GARNER v. RAVEN INDUSTRIES, INC.

No. 82-1234.

732 F.2d 112 (1984)

Michael D. GARNER, a/k/a Mike Garner,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. RAVEN INDUSTRIES, INC., Defendant-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Tenth Circuit.

April 11, 1984.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

William Gilstrap, Albuquerque, N.M. (Willard F. Kitts and Elizabeth E. Whitefield, Kitts & Whitefield, Albuquerque, N.M., with him on brief), for plaintiff-appellant.

Mark C. Meiering, Rodey, Dickason, Sloan, Akin & Robb, Albuquerque, N.M., for defendant-appellee.

Before DOYLE and LOGAN, Circuit Judges, and CHILSON, District Judge.


WILLIAM E. DOYLE, Circuit Judge.

This is a personal injury case in which federal jurisdiction is based upon diversity of citizenship. The plaintiff herein sought recovery from the defendant manufacturer of a helium filled, blimp-shaped balloon. Plaintiff alleged that defendant, Raven Industries, Inc., was liable based on negligence and strict products liability. However, the case was tried only upon the basis of whether there was negligence on the part of Raven Industries...
